Jesse Lee United Methodist Church’s new Pastor Fern Blair Hart will be at the church from 9 a.m. to 12 p.m. on Ash Wednesday, March 2, to hand out ashes. No appointment is necessary, just come to the front door of the sanctuary.

There will also be a service that evening at 7:30 p.m. in the church sanctuary at 25 Flat Rock Rd. The choir will sing and ashes will be distributed.

Pastor Hart is a lifelong Methodist and found her calling to ministry after a 36-year career as an elementary school teacher in Bethel where she resides and a secretary-dispatcher for the city of Danbury. During Pastor Fern’s “retirement” she became a certified Lay Minister and then went on to attend Local Pastor’s Licensing School, completing her course of studies in 2015.

Jesse Lee is Pastor Fern’s second appointment, having previously served in Canaan, Conn. Over its long history of over 200 years, Pastor Fern will only be the second woman to serve Jesse Lee as its spiritual leader. We welcome her to her new church home.
